Output befb4996124652cf0c3c613c7469baf2b360d1c360569df476c9fcb16b37bb97:0

value
756390062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f436655a95919070ac3ebbb15d41e98f057fb286 OP_EQUAL
address
3PxHxqwqB95e5jcDfaE8Y1kTeosxRFsc1q
transaction
befb4996124652cf0c3c613c7469baf2b360d1c360569df476c9fcb16b37bb97
spent
true